保存pom.xml文件后,Maven会自动下载FreeTTS及其依赖库。 二、示例代码 接下来,我们将编写一个简单的Java程序,使用FreeTTS将文本转换为语音。以下是完整的示例代码: AI检测代码解析 importcom.sun.speech.freetts.Voice;importcom.sun.speech.freetts.VoiceManager;publicclassTextToSpeech{privatestaticfinalStringVOICE_N...
所谓的sql注入 ,就是通过把SQL命令加入到请求的字符串中,最终达到七篇服务器执行恶意SQL命令。 select id,username,userpassword,age from user where username='zzz' and userpassword='123' or 'a'='a' 1. 2. 5.2开发中需要注意的事项 AI检测代码解析 1: 永远不要信任用户的输入 。 2: 不要使用动态拼...
如果你不使用Maven,需要手动下载FreeTTS的JAR文件,并将其添加到项目的构建路径中。 准备需要转换成语音的文本: 定义一个字符串变量,存储你想要转换成语音的文本。 java String text = "你好,欢迎使用离线文字转语音功能。"; 创建Voice对象并设置属性: 使用FreeTTS库,你需要创建一个Voice对象,并设置其属性,如语速...
添加FreeTTS库到你的Java项目 如果你使用构建工具(如Maven或Gradle),你需要将FreeTTS的依赖添加到你的构建文件中。由于FreeTTS可能不是通过中央仓库分发的,你可能需要手动下载jar文件并将其添加到你的项目类路径中。 编写Java代码使用FreeTTS 下面是一个简单的Java代码示例,展示了如何使用FreeTTS进行TTS转换: ...
FreeTTS是一个纯Java实现的文本到语音引擎,适合简单的本地应用。 步骤 添加依赖: 如果你使用Maven,可以在pom.xml中添加FreeTTS的依赖: <dependency> <groupId>com.sun.speech</groupId> <artifactId>freetts</artifactId> <version>1.2.2</version> </dependency> 编写代码: import com.sun.speech.freetts....
FreeTTS mavenized FreeTTS Speech Synthesis System Install TODO demo (wip) main in tests volume for jsapi v1.0-> already implemented 1.2.4 mac voice? ... mbrola FreeTTS is a speech synthesis system written entirely in the Java programming language. It is based upon Flite, a small, fast,...
1. Download FreeTTS: http://freetts.sourceforge.net/ 2. 解压后运行:D:\software\freetts-1.2\lib\jsapi.exe, 选择agree. 3. 写helloworld程序,语音读出"MPLS alarm: link down": import java.util.Locale; import javax.speech.Central; import javax.speech.EngineList; ...
这通常涉及到使用构建工具(如Maven或Gradle)将插件打包成一个可执行的文件(如JAR文件),并在插件市场上注册账号并上传插件。 八、实际应用与前景展望 数字人直播插件在实际应用中具有广泛的前景。它可以应用于各种直播场景,如电商直播、教育直播、娱乐直播等。通过使用数字人直播插件,可以实现虚拟主播的自动化管理和运营...
Maven:https://github.com/marytts/marytts-txt2wav/tree/maven Gradle:https://github.com/marytts/marytts-txt2wav/tree/gradle Using MaryTTS for other programming languages If you want to use MaryTTS for other programming languages (like python for example), you need to achieve 3 steps ...
51CTO博客已为您找到关于java如何通过maven引入Freetts包的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及java如何通过maven引入Freetts包问答内容。更多java如何通过maven引入Freetts包相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进